Output 139b588868efa02fc877398a8a9cc6e97477a5eef917034a4252676950994c85:27

value
349532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f385ae266ae06880ea9b8a7ea650d5e422f564 OP_EQUAL
address
38ccL9cbRZK1GkJ9jVAthSz5ijX6gmH2sg
transaction
139b588868efa02fc877398a8a9cc6e97477a5eef917034a4252676950994c85
spent
true